The BJ42D15-26V10 is a 2-phase NEMA 17 bipolar stepper motor manufactured by Hunan Keli Motor. It is commonly found as a stock component in Creality 3D printers, such as the Ender 3 series, typically used for the X, Y, or Z axes.
